1. 設置數據庫字符集
在創建數據庫時,可以設置數據庫的字符集為utf8,創建數據庫的語句如下:
ame CHARACTER SET utf8;
2. 設置表字符集
在創建表時,也可以設置表的字符集為utf8,創建表的語句如下:
ame (n1 datatype CHARACTER SET utf8,n2 datatype CHARACTER SET utf8,
.....
3. 修改表字符集
如果已經創建了表,但表的字符集不是utf8,可以通過以下命令修改表字符集:
ame CONVERT TO CHARACTER SET utf8;
4. 修改字段字符集
如果已經創建了表,但某個字段的字符集不是utf8,可以通過以下命令修改字段字符集:
amename datatype CHARACTER SET utf8;
5. 修改連接字符集
在連接MySQL時,可以設置連接字符集為utf8,連接MySQL的命令如下:
ysqlame -p --default-character-set=utf8
以上是解決MySQL查詢數據中文亂碼問題的幾種方法。在實際開發中,需要根據具體情況選擇合適的方法來解決中文亂碼問題。